A comprehensive guide to the charter member application form

Overview of the charter member application form

A charter member application form serves as a gateway for individuals seeking to join an organization or community as founding members. This form is not just a standard application; it embodies the values and mission of the organization, ensuring that prospective members align with them. Additionally, it plays a critical role in maintaining the integrity and quality of the community by vetting applicants before granting membership.

Definition: A document used by organizations to assess and admit new founding members.
Purpose: To ensure that applicants meet specified criteria.
Importance: Helps to form a cohesive group that upholds the organization's values.

Understanding the benefits of charter membership

Becoming a charter member often comes with a variety of benefits that can significantly enhance both professional and personal growth. One of the primary advantages is the opportunity to connect with like-minded individuals, creating a network that can lead to collaborative projects, mentorship opportunities, and shared knowledge. Furthermore, charter members frequently gain exclusive access to resources, events, and information that are not available to the general public.

The credibility that comes with being a charter member cannot be overstated; it often positions individuals as leaders within their community, increasing their visibility and recognition. This status can enhance their professional reputation, making it easier to establish partnerships and gain trust.

Networking opportunities: Connect with industry leaders and peers.
Access to exclusive resources and events: Participate in workshops, webinars, and networking events.
Enhanced credibility: Build a reputable presence in your field.

Common mistakes to avoid in the application

While completing the charter member application form, applicants can sometimes make avoidable mistakes that may hinder their chances of acceptance. Common pitfalls include incomplete information, such as missing required fields or failing to provide necessary documentation. Another common error is incorrectly selecting the membership type; this can lead to your application being misclassified or rejected.

Additionally, not following the formatting guidelines can detract from the overall professionalism of the submission. It's essential to adhere to any specific guidelines provided by the organization, as they can demonstrate your ability to follow instructions and present information clearly.

Incomplete information: Ensure all fields are filled out completely.
Incorrectly selecting membership types: Research options thoroughly before making a selection.
Not following formatting guidelines: Adhere to organization-specific formatting rules.

A charter member application is a formal request to become a founding member of an organization or association, typically submitted to establish a foundational membership status.
Individuals or entities interested in becoming founding members of an organization are required to file a charter member application.
To fill out a charter member application, applicants should complete all required fields, provide necessary documentation, and submit the application to the designated authority or organization.
The purpose of a charter member application is to formally acknowledge and register individuals or entities as founding members, allowing them to participate in foundational activities and decisions.
Information typically required on a charter member application includes the applicant's name, contact information, background information, and any relevant qualifications or contributions to the organization.
